Welcome aboard. This page covers break-glass access for the Scanbridge barcode scanner integration. Use it only when the normal deploy path is down and scans are failing at Merrow Depot. Break-glass sessions are logged and reviewed weekly. To open an emergency session, the console will ask for the passphrase shown below.

vault phrase of kawep-tahog = ulaix-briath

**Ticket: Firmware channel drift on Lintbox gateways**

Field units in the Harrowgate fleet are pulling from the beta firmware channel instead of stable. Drift introduced during the Velora rollout; the channel pin was never reapplied after the registry swap. No evidence of tampering, but review requested before we force-sync. Current channel configuration as deployed follows below.

settings of tagag-kawep:
OLIAEL_HOST=oliael.zemvarsys.internal
OLIAEL_PORT=5672

## Deployment

Tracewick propagates request IDs across every microservice in the Pellaro stack. Deploy the collector first, then the per-service agents; order matters because agents refuse to start without a reachable collector. Spans are sampled at the edge, so downstream services never need their own sampling logic. Rolling restarts are safe — trace context survives in headers. If you change the header format, bump the schema version everywhere at once. Each environment ships with the configuration shown below.

config for kagup-hahig:
druwyn:
  pin: 2801
  metrics_host: metrics.druwyn.zemvarlabs.internal
  tenant: sorius
  seal: seal_798a43d7